Day Six Of the Festival

Today at the festival I decided to see all of the print advertisements  that are nominated for awards at the festival. The advertisements displayed are anything from public relations campaigns to social experiments to non profit events.  This is my favorite thing I have stumbled upon while in Cannes. All of the ads are unique and creative. My favorite ad was from a  Chinese advertising agency for a stain remover. The picture depicted two couples having dinner together, each couple holding hands with their significant others. Then the viewer sees the reflection of the table and one man has his hand on the other woman's leg. The caption is '' no filth can go unseen.'' I thought this was a great way to incorporate a brand into a print ad while still catching the viewers eye. Another great ad I saw today was for a shampoo brand. The print ad had pictures of three males facing you with extremely long beards. The picture is actually an illusion because their ''beards'' are the backs of various women's heads. The illusion of their long hair under the mens faces to create ''beards'' is a fun way of promoting hair growth and keeping the viewer engaged with what the product is supposed to do.
